Liana Bangkok is a contemporary French fine dining restaurant offering a seasonal menu in harmony with the European seasonal change. It proudly presents aromatic, fresh, and light French dishes with subtle elegance, highlighting the beauty of local ingredients. The restaurant is the brainchild of two founding chefs with diverse backgrounds but a shared passion for cooking: Thai-born Warat Areerom, also known as Head Chef Bic, and his Korean wife, Pastry Chef Soohyun Lee. They draw inspiration from nature to craft Liana’s distinctive offerings, blending seasonal ingredients and modern French technique with cultural influences from both chefs.

Chef Bic and Chef Soohyun first met at Tante Marie Culinary Academy in London, the UK’s longest-established cookery school. They later worked together at the two-Michelin-starred Marcus Belgravia under Chef Marcus Wareing, honing both classical techniques and contemporary presentations in a fine dining environment.

With extensive experience in London’s fine dining scene, both chefs bring a strong culinary foundation, weaving their heritage into the gastronomy that defines Liana.

Chef Bic, being Thai, showcases his versatility with local ingredients, adapting them into seasonal menus that evolve throughout the year. Chef Soohyun, drawing on her Korean background, elevates the dining experience with delicate desserts that surprise and delight.

In the creative process of developing new menus, Chef Bic envisions the mood of each seasonal offering, selecting colors and standout ingredients from the market. He collaborates closely with Chef Soohyun to ensure every element harmonizes with the dining journey. Freshness and quality remain their top priority—over 90% of fruits and vegetables are sourced directly from local farmers, while seafood is carefully selected from Southern Thailand.

Liana’s approach to service is welcoming, friendly, and attentive, while ensuring that the high standards of fine dining are consistently met. At the helm is Restaurant Manager Hanbit Lee, originally from Korea, who brings a wealth of multicultural experience from The Ritz-Carlton Key Biscayne, Miami, Royal Caribbean Cruises, and Arcane, a Michelin-starred restaurant in Hong Kong. Hanbit ensures that her team genuinely connects with each guest, making the dining experience more personal and meaningful.

Step into Liana, and guests are immediately embraced by a sense of warmth, welcome, and tranquility. Inspired by the liana vine found in tropical rainforests, the dining room boasts a curved wall that echoes its free-flowing form, complemented by lighting that mimics sunlight filtering through a canopy.

At the heart of the space, stone and wood converge in a kitchen counter, symbolizing the elements of the forest and strengthening the connection to nature. The live kitchen brings an engaging dimension to dining—where French artistry and Asian heritage come alive before guests’ eyes. This open setting embodies the freshness of ingredients and the finesse of the chefs, creating a sensory journey that transforms every dish into a memorable experience.
Expect the unexpected at Liana, where guests embark on a culinary journey guided by the rhythm of the seasons.

The menu begins at THB 3,750++ for five courses, or THB 5,250++ for eight courses.

Wine pairings are also available: three glasses at THB 1,750++, five glasses at THB 2,890++, and seven glasses at THB 3,940++.

The restaurant is open Wednesday to Sunday for dinner from 5:30 PM, with last seating at 8:30 PM.
